Default What color are your side view mirrors?

I just bought an 06 is350 an noticed that my drivers and passengers mirror are different colors. The drivers side has a blue tint to it while the passengers side has a gold tint to it. I wanted to see what color someone elses mirrors were. I have the luxury package if that matters.

I had a chance to to test the auto dimming in my car. If I put my finger over the light sensor on the back of the rear view mirror during the day all three mirrors dim. It seems as if the drivers mirror is not un-dimming all the way because it stays this light blue color during the day. I don't know if maybe the mirror is wearing out or something is wrong with it.

There are 2 sensors on the rear view mirror one on the back that senses when its dark out, and the one on the front that senses light from cars behind you.
